An old family photo was left in a donation bin. This Kansas library wants to find the owner

Posted at 7:55 PM, Nov 19, 2018
and last updated 2018-11-20 11:59:49-05

KANSAS CITY, Mo. The Johnson County Library is searching for the owner of an old family photo it believes was mistakenly left at the library.

A library employee found the photo in the donation bin at the Lackman Library in Lenexa, Kansas.

"Because of that we don't know who dropped it off, where it came from or who it belongs to," said Josh Neff, an information specialist at the library.

The photo was left in the bin in March and the library has been holding on to it ever since.

"We have been holding on to it hoping that whoever accidentally lost it, would think to come back here and ask about it. But so far nobody has claimed it," said Neff.

Now, the library is turning to social media in hopes of finding the photo's owner. On Monday, the library posted the image on Facebook and Twitter.

"We know the power of social media. We know that it's a great way to spread the message," Neff said. "So we are hoping that power will help this photograph get back to who it belongs to."
